Tenacious D Rize of the Fenix
Great Album, I've now listened to it a fair few times and I absolutely love it. Much of this album has such good guitar work notably "Senorita" and "Deth Starr". A number of songs on this album remind me of Led Zepplin - IV and Iron Maiden style riffs and you cannot ignore Dave Grohl's brilliant Drumming.rIts an album that is quite good on the ears, more so to people who have not even heard of Tenacious D. For fans its massive progress since "Pick Of Destiny" its also more musically matured than the first album. My only annoyance with this album is that its not nearly as big as the other two, it only has 13 songs but some of them only peak at 3 minutes. Still the music is quite concentrated and distracts from this side of the album. The comedy is still brilliant, but you can't ignore how good JB and KG are as musicians.
